At 64, Brian Rezendes from rural North Dakota has embraced AI through vibe coding, building custom tools to simplify his life. His journey began at a hardware store, where he used AI to manage inventory and avoid physically taxing audits. Now, he has created “TrixieHQ,” a personalized app that helps him navigate complex legal paperwork, saving thousands in attorney fees.
Older American Embraces Vibe Coding for Daily Life
Rezendes also designs websites for his wife and experiments with AI‑generated YouTube content. Despite skepticism from peers, he sees technology as empowering, especially for older Americans, and hopes his projects will support retirement and lifelong learning.
